AC Milan have signed Swedish striker Zlatan Ibrahimovic on a free transfer until the end of the season with an option for a further year, the Serie A club announced on Friday. Ibrahimovic, 38, returns to Milan where he helped the club win their last league title in 2010-11 and scored 56 goals in 85 games in two seasons.
